What is the largest park in Denver, Colorado?
Denver, Colorado is home to a variety of beautiful parks that offer a range of activities for both locals and tourists. However, the largest park in Denver is City Park. Covering 330 acres, City Park is located in the heart of Denver and is one of the oldest and most popular parks in the city.
City Park is home to a variety of attractions, including the Denver Zoo, the Denver Museum of Nature and Science, and two lakes that offer boating and fishing. The park also features numerous trails for walking, jogging, and biking, as well as several playgrounds, picnic areas, and sports fields.
Visitors to City Park can enjoy stunning views of the Rocky Mountains and Denver skyline, making it a popular spot for photography and picnics. The park is also home to numerous events throughout the year, including concerts, festivals, and cultural celebrations.
